Quarterly Town Halls
We prioritize open and transparent communication at our company. It’s one of the key factors that sets us apart. To demonstrate our commitment, we host quarterly Town Halls to provide company updates, share information on initiatives and programs and celebrate the successes of the previous quarter. These events also provide valuable opportunities to spotlight our Creators’ accomplishments.
One of the greatest benefits of our Town Halls is the direct interaction with our Executive Leadership Team. We believe in fostering global connections and ensuring that each of our Creators has a voice. That’s why a significant portion of the event is dedicated to live Q&A, where our Creators can receive direct answers to their questions.

In addition to the company-wide Town Hall, our CFO Finance Division also holds quarterly Town Halls. We issue quarterly CFO Awards to our Creators to recognize outstanding contributions in five different categories: Team of the Quarter, Cross-Functional Player of the Quarter, Rookie of the Quarter, MVP of the Quarter and Manager of the Quarter. By acknowledging our teams’ outstanding achievements, we can help our Creators feel rightfully celebrated and encouraged to consistently deliver their best.

Book Crews
Light & Wonder hosts a global book club and invites Creators to join as book crew participants or leaders. To ensure smooth coordination, we organize Creators into small groups of five to eight people in a similar region, making it easier to schedule virtual meetings. Our crew leaders receive discussion guides to lead engaging conversations and guide their clubs through the book’s themes and insights.
Through the book club, we foster a community of intellectual exploration and create space where we can expand our horizons, exchange diverse perspectives and grow together.
Previous book selections include:
• Unapologetically Ambitious by Shellye Archambeau
• Leaders Eat Last by Simon Sinek
• Becoming by Michelle Obama
• Delivering Happiness: A Path to Profits, Passion, and Purpose by Tony Hsieh
• Forget a Mentor, Find a Sponsor by Sylvia
Ann Hewlett

Week Of Wishes
Since its establishment in 2020, the Week of Wishes has grown into a cherished annual tradition at our company. During this time, our Creators can submit a wish for themselves, a colleague, friend or family member who could use an extra financial boost during the holidays.
We’ve seen wishes granted for a Creator’s nephew who needed an electric wheelchair and to surprise a colleague with a celebratory dinner after their 20th anniversary plans were interrupted by an illness. We’ve helped colleagues rebuild their homes after devastating fires and relieve the financial stress of medical bills, supported a co-worker’s child in need of a special walker and facilitated the purchase of a car to transport their loved one to and from cancer treatments.
In 2022, we expanded the reach of Week of Wishes to include every Creator at Light & Wonder as well as our partners at SciPlay. The response was overwhelming, and we were able to grant 243 wishes — far more than the 50 granted the previous year.
This initiative is a heartfelt example of the compassion and generosity that defines our company culture and reminds us of the remarkable difference we can make in each other’s lives. Momentum
In 2021, we launched our new Learning & Development program, Momentum. We handpicked over 60 Manager to Director-level Creators to take part in the class. Over the course of six months, these talented Creators delved into the ins and outs of our Gaming division, exploring corporate business partnership roles and opportunities within Legal, Investor Relations and Human Resources.
Led by senior leaders in the Gaming Business Unit, participants learned about game design, product management, financial statements and how to foster a high-performance culture. Alongside the live courses, participants also received mentorship and personal growth assessments, and they engaged in a final project to identify a business opportunity or raise funds to support a CSR initiative. In keeping with the program’s fitting name, Momentum has been a game-changer, helping our talented, dedicated Creators excel in their careers.
Best Games Workshop
At this highly anticipated event, game creators from all disciplines, including land-based, digital and social games, come together to collaborate and workshop their ideas. Spanning three days, the event features an immersive learning experience and a unique chance to pitch game concepts for potential launch across all Light & Wonder platforms — including Gaming, iGaming and social channels. Best Games Workshop brings together the best of our Creators’ innovation and creativity and helps pave the way for thrilling new games to capture audiences worldwide.

SPOTLIGHT Artists Among Us



Our Artists Among Us (AAU) program was established in 2013 in Chicago as an annual exhibit that showcases the incredible artistic talent within our company through thought-provoking and captivating art pieces across various mediums — paintings, digital art, sculpture, photography and more. Founded by two long-standing employees and artists, Dave Pryor and Steve Zoloto, the AAU program is a window into our diverse, passionate and innovative teams of Creators. Their inspiration and skill are part of what makes us a leader in the game industry.
Over the years, this cultural event has become a beloved company-wide program, expanding organically from Chicago to Las Vegas, Sydney, London and Pune. All of our Creators are welcome to participate, regardless of skill level or job position. Each year, submissions revolve around a theme, inspiring artists to explore their creativity within the given framework. Past themes have included ”Home is Where the Art Is,” ”Star Trek” and ”Wonder Woman.” In 2022, the AAU theme was “Manifest.”
Creator artwork is proudly displayed in company galleries at various Light & Wonder locations as well as in a virtual showcase, allowing visitors to appreciate and engage with the diverse range of talent within our organization. The artists themselves play an active role in collecting, curating, installing and promoting the exhibits, which deepens the sense of pride and community throughout our global creative teams.
